Wallace Teuscher - Class of 1946

Dr. Wallace Vaughn Teuscher, 88, of Vancouver, WA, passed away Wednesday, August 24, 2016 at his home surrounded by his beloved family. He was born June 3, 1928 in Montpelier, ID to Wallace and Minerva Teuscher.

As a young man, Wally attended and graduated from Montpelier High School, then moved on to attend Idaho State College, where he received his Bachelor's degree.

Shortly thereafter, Wally joined the Army and honorably served for a period of 2 years.

Following his discharge, he moved to Oregon to attend Dental school at the University of Oregon. At a church activity, Wally met a young lady named Joan. They fell in love and later were married, in the Logan, Utah Temple.

After his graduation, Wally and Joan moved to Vancouver where he began his dental practice. He was involved in many dental organizations over the years and was the Charter President of the WA Academy of General Dentistry in 1976. He practiced dentistry for over 50 years, retiring at the age of 79.

Wally's spiritual life was very important to him. He was a lifetime member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ints. He was deeply involved in the church and church service, including being Stake President, Branch President, Bishop, and Stake Patriarch.

In addition to involvement in his church, Wally was also a dedicated member of the Lions Club for 49 years and served with the Boy Scouts from 1975-2005. During his involvement with the Lions, he held a number of positions, including President of the Fort Vancouver Chapter. He was recognized as Lion of the Year in 1988. While with the Boy Scouts, he served as Area Vice President for the Columbia Pacific Council 1988-1992.

When Wally wasn't busy with his work, community involvement, and his family, he enjoyed many hobbies including real estate, poetry, fishing, hunting, watching sports, traveling, and even piloting planes.

One of his greatest joys in life was being surrounded by his children and grandchildren.
